WebGoldenrod gets an undeserved reputation as the late summer hay fever contributor when it is actually ragweed that is the true culprit. While goldenrod does have pollen, it is sticky and not wind borne like that of ragweed. They bloom at the same time, however, which prompts the blame. WebSolidago altissima (Tall Goldenrod) is a rhizomatous, spreading perennial boasting tall, upright, central stems clad with narrowly lance-shaped leaves, 4-6 in. long (10-15 cm), usually with small teeth along the margins. In the fall, it bears densely packed clusters of dark yellow flowers along one side of arching branches. WebAug 15, 2024 · Ragweed season peaks in fall, typically around mid-September. The pollen development in ragweed species occurs when temperatures drop below 60 and the nights get longer. August through November are the worst months for those affected by ragweed allergies. Ragweed plants are killed by hard frosts. WebSep 21, 2024 · Goldenrod is a showy, conspicuous plant and because of that, it has often been blamed as the cause for fall hay fever. Actually, ragweed ( Ambrosia spp.) is the major culprit of nasal distress. Ragweed blooms at the same time as goldenrod, but its small, dull, yellow-green flowers do not attract the eye of humans, nor many insect pollinators. WebSep 7, 2014 · Goldenrod should be one of the classic flowers of fall but it gets a bad rap because it blooms at the same time that hayfever sufferers begin sneezing. Ragweed flowers, which are the real culprits, are tiny so it is the showy goldenrod that gets blamed for the suffering. Ragweed pollen is spread by the wind.
